State Highway Administration - Route 5 Reconstruction Project at Great Mills
Sponsor: Brian M. Crosby (District 29B)Committee: AppropriationsSubject: Transportation - HighwaysStatus: Hearing 3/08 at 1:00 p.m. (as of Nov 15, 2022)
What this bill does
Official synopsis
Requiring the State Highway Administration to undertake all steps necessary to complete the Route 5 Reconstruction Project at Great Mills; requiring the Governor to appropriate the necessary amount of funding for the Route 5 Reconstruction Project; and requiring the Route 5 Reconstruction Project to be constructed and commence operation on or before June 30, 2025.
